Commercial Slab Installation in Franklin, TN
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of large-scale property projects. These services are commonly requested for constructing new commercial buildings, warehouses, parking lots, loading docks, and other structures that require a solid, level base. Property owners should understand the importance of proper site preparation, including soil assessment and grading, to ensure the longevity and stability of the slab. Additionally, considerations such as load-bearing capacity, thickness, and reinforcement options are essential factors that influence the durability of the finished foundation.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ners often seek information about the scope of the project, including the size and layout of the slab, as well as any specific structural requirements. Understanding local building codes and permitting processes is also important to ensure compliance. Clear communication about the intended use of the space, environmental conditions, and future plans can help determine the appropriate type of concrete and reinforcement needed. Proper planning and consultation can contribute to a successful installation that supports the long-term functionality of the property.

Common Commercial Slab Installation Jobs
Commercial slab installation involves preparing and pouring concrete slabs for various business and industrial buildings.
Parking lot slabs are essential for creating durable, level surfaces for vehicle access and parking.
Warehouse flooring requires strong, even slabs to support heavy equipment and inventory.
Sidewalk and walkway slabs provide safe, stable walking surfaces around commercial properties.
Loading dock slabs are designed to withstand frequent vehicle traffic and heavy loads.
Foundation slabs serve as the base for commercial structures, ensuring stability and proper load distribution.
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on business properties.
How thick are typical commercial slabs? The thickness of commercial slabs varies depending on the intended use, generally ranging from 4 to 12 inches to support heavy loads and traffic.
What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material used for commercial slabs,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h for added strength and durability.
What should property owners consider before installation? It’s important to evaluate the soil condition, drainage needs, and load requirements to ensure a proper and long-lasting slab installation.
